Take Heart focuses on training handicapped and blind students in India with vocational employment skills. We support practical education projects as a means to give people the skills needs to gain employment or start a company. We believe ‘Work builds, charity destroys’.

As I may have let slip to a small minority of you, I decided to enter the ballot for this year's Flora London Marathon, believing that there wasn't a chance I'd ever get selected.  Almost a year on, sure enough, I'm putting the final touches to my training...

I am running the marathon on 26th April in aid of Take Heart, and would be extremely grateful for any contribution you are able to make towards this worthy cause.  Take Heart is a charity run by a very good university friend of mine, Lucian Tarnowski.  Based in India, Take Heart provides practical education and employment skills to physically handicapped and blind young people, enabling them to be self-supporting and integrate back into society.  Its primary aim is to help people regain their sense of dignity and self-worth in life.
